Insomnia is often described as a sleep problem.
In reality, it’s usually a state-of-alert problem.
Many people feel exhausted all day, yet struggle to fall asleep or stay asleep at night.
Others notice their mind becomes more active precisely when they try to rest.

How the nervous system influences sleep
Sleep doesn’t happen because you’re tired.
It happens when your body feels safe enough to let go.
An overstimulated nervous system can keep the mind alert and the body tense, even when exhaustion is present. This explains many modern sleep struggles.

Why the mind becomes louder at night
Many people notice that their thoughts intensify as soon as they lie down.
This isn’t random.
When external stimulation disappears, accumulated stress often surfaces.

Feeling exhausted all day but awake at night
Daytime fatigue does not guarantee nighttime sleep.
In fact, chronic stress can drain energy without calming the body.

When trying harder makes sleep worse
Sleep is one of the few biological processes that cannot be forced.
Pressure, control, and effort often increase alertness instead of rest.
